Sage MAS 200 hangs at splash screen on one or more workstations

If using Sage MAS 200 you may experience the following symptom:

After double clicking the MAS 200 icon on a workstation, the splash screen launches and hangs without any error or other message.

The following steps may help you diagnose this issue:

1. Make sure you can ping the server both IP and Name - this rules in/out a connectivity problem

2. Make sure you can PING THE WORKSTATION having the problem. In many instances a Windows (or other program) update can modify the firewall settings. For proper MAS 200 operations you MUST be able to ping the workstation from the server.

3. Replace the server name with the IP address in the local sota.ini (Note: This will be the SOTA.INI found on the local computer not the server -- do a search - it will be in the mas90\home\launcher folder)

4. Determine if other workstations can login -- if so then the problem is isolated to this one station -- if not look at the system as a whole -- the first suspect should be sy0ctl.soa. Try restoring this from a backup.
